How much does the Georgia Aquarium cost?

The cost of visiting the Georgia Aquarium depends on various factors, such as age, type of ticket, and any additional experiences. As of 2021, the general admission price for adults (ages 13-64) is $39.95, while children (ages 3-12) can enter for $33.95. Seniors (ages 65+) receive a special discounted rate of $36.95. However, it’s important to keep in mind that ticket prices might vary, and it’s always a good idea to check the official website for the most up-to-date information.

FAQs:

1. Are there any discounts available?

Yes, the Georgia Aquarium offers discounts for military personnel, college students, and groups of 25 or more. Additionally, there are various combo tickets available that allow visitors to explore multiple attractions within Atlanta at a discounted rate.

2. Do children under a certain age get in for free?

Children under the age of 2 can enter the Georgia Aquarium for free.

3. What additional experiences are available?

The Georgia Aquarium offers several additional experiences, such as the opportunity to dive or swim with whale sharks, beluga whales, or manta rays. These experiences require separate tickets and have varying prices.

4. Can I purchase tickets online?

Yes, purchasing tickets online in advance is highly recommended. It not only saves you time but also ensures you secure your desired date and time slot.

5. Are there any restrictions due to COVID-19?

Due to the ongoing pandemic, the Georgia Aquarium has implemented safety measures and capacity restrictions. It is advisable to check their website for the latest updates on COVID-19 protocols and restrictions.

6. Is parking available at the Georgia Aquarium?

Yes, the Georgia Aquarium provides parking facilities for visitors. However, parking is not included in the ticket price and will require an additional fee.

7. How long does a visit to the Georgia Aquarium typically last?

The duration of your visit to the Georgia Aquarium can vary depending on various factors, such as your level of interest and the crowd size. On average, visitors spend about 2-3 hours exploring the aquarium.

8. Can I bring my own food and drinks?

Outside food and drinks are not permitted inside the Georgia Aquarium. However, there are several dining options available inside the facility.

9. Can I bring a stroller inside the aquarium?

Yes, strollers are allowed inside the aquarium. However, it’s important to keep in mind that certain exhibits or areas may have stroller restrictions.

10. Is the Georgia Aquarium wheelchair accessible?

Yes, the Georgia Aquarium is wheelchair accessible. It provides ramps and elevators to ensure all visitors can enjoy their experience.

11. Can I leave the aquarium and come back later?

Yes, with a valid admission ticket, visitors are allowed to exit the aquarium and return later in the same day without any additional charge. Just make sure to retain your ticket for re-entry.

12. Can I take photographs inside the aquarium?

Photography is permitted inside the Georgia Aquarium. However, the use of tripods and flash photography may be restricted in certain areas to ensure the safety of the animals and visitors.
